New carport incorporates solar panels

A free standing, two-car carport that has solar panels integrated into its structure has been announced by Lumos Solar as a new addition to their wide array of solar products for both residential and commercial customers.

The Lumos PowerPort Solar Carport addresses a growing need for alternative energy installation options to meet the diverse needs of potential clients interested in solar but hesitant at the thought of placing panels on their roofs. Lumos refers to their unique integration of solar systems into architecture as SolarscapesTM. This method of solar installation offers aesthetically pleasing alternatives for renewable energy installations while adding the functionality of providing shade and shelter from the elements. Solarscapes offer the additional benefit of being able to be positioned optimally when traditional rooftop systems will not work due to excessive shading or orientation of the rooftop.

The Lumos PowerPort Solar Carport incorporates innovative double-sided (bifacial) solar panels manufactured by Sanyo. These modules are optimal for this type of freestanding structure since they also generate energy from the backside of the panel as ambient light passes through or is reflected off surrounding surfaces.

The Lumos PowerPort Solar Carport is designed to be a turnkey system that can be delivered virtually anywhere and takes only one day to install. This 3.42-kilowatt structure not only provides shade and shelter for vehicles, but also generates enough electricity to offset a modest household’s electrical needs or the recharging of two electric vehicles.

Renewable energy has never been more accessible thanks to innovations like the Solar Carport giving home and business owners viable options to offset their energy consumption. According to Scott Franklin, president of Lumos Solar, “The PowerPort Solar Carport is an easy, attractive and super functional way to maximize an investment in a solar energy system for a home or business.”

Solar energy is one way to greatly offset the negative effects from non-renewable energy sources like petroleum, coal and natural gas, not to mention the social and financial implications to our society and on a global scale. Dependence on fossil fuels from foreign sources weakens our nation’s security and economic base whereas local, decentralized energy production is the key to our energy independence and security.

As carbon dioxide emission levels continue to rise in the atmosphere causing marked changes in climate and the environment, renewable energy has never been more important. Solar power is an infinitely renewable, clean and unlimited energy resource. There is enough energy from the sun hitting the earth’s surface in just one day to supply the energy needs of the entire world for one year.

In the past, access to renewable energy resources was limited due to cost and efficiencies but this trend is reversing as non-renewable energy prices continue to soar and renewable energy technologies continue to improve.
